Output 82a1475aa195cc227359668430940c33908226e36f923e62165557cea0061010:30

value
40947608
script pubkey
OP_0 OP_PUSHBYTES_20 21fec522845a4816e0987decbed157f26457644f
address
ltc1qy8lv2g5ytfypdcyc0hkta52h7fj9wez0t3qvcz
transaction
82a1475aa195cc227359668430940c33908226e36f923e62165557cea0061010
spent
true